修复损坏的虚拟机文件(vmx)

今天运气真TMD的被,在vmvare里面装win7 64的虚拟机,vmvare居然默认安装在C盘,结果各种环境配好后,C盘占用满了,win7 down掉了,说vmx不是有效的虚拟机文件,关键是重要文件在里面,幸好网上有修复vmx文件的方法:

修复方法:

本方法仅适用.vmx文件损坏而其他文件完好无损的情况。

举例说明:虚拟机名为XP,虚拟机目录为E:\XP\,配置文件名即为XP.vmx(除目录名为自己创建为,其余文件名为VM虚拟机自动创建)

1,删除XP.vmx(注意不要删除错了,系统默认是不显示扩展名的,显示扩展名的方法自己百度一下吧)

2,用记事本打开E:\XP\vmware.log

3,找到“Jan 24 23:13:15.438: vmx| DICT --- CONFIGURATION”段(前面是日期和时间,不要对号入座)

4,从下边一行开始复制到“Jan 24 23:13:15.440: vmx| DICT --- USER DEFAULTS”上边一行结束(不用复制 ‘---CONFIG??’和‘ ---USER DEFA?.’两行)

5,新建记事本,粘贴已复制文本

6,删除前边的日期时间标志   例如:“Jan 24 23:13:15.438: vmx| DICT            config.version = 8”

删除前边标志后仅留“config.version = 8”

7,照上边格式全部修改,然后给所有行的等号后的字符加上英文双引号(注意不要使用中文输入法的双引号)

例如:config.version = 8 改为config.version = "8"

8,照上边格式全部修改。

9,确认修改无误后,保存为“虚拟机名.vmx”,和原配置文件名相同,例如XP.vmx

10,打开vmx文件,开启虚拟机

已经无力吐槽vmvare,一开始就对它没什么好感,默认C盘就不说了,防护措施这么差,真TM浪费时间。

时间: 2024-10-25 13:02:15

修复损坏的虚拟机文件(vmx)的相关文章

视频修复工具修复损坏avi视频文件

视频损坏该怎么办,用视频修复工具呀,但是这么多的数据恢复工具,到底哪款可以修复出我要的视频文件呢? 这应该是很多遇到视频损坏的客户都会遇到的问题,那么到底该怎么解决呢? 今天甲驭科技数据恢复中心小编给大家推荐一款合适的视频修复工具,让你用的放心,用的满意. 来自湖北十堰的王小姐通过网络搜索联系到了甲驭科技数据恢复中心,她就遇到了比较麻烦的问题.她是做后期编辑处理的,这次主要是存储在个人笔记本电脑中的众多已经编辑好的avi视频文件不知道什么原因都损坏了无法打开了,但是原片又没有了,而且有些视频文件

发现VMware4.1没有修复模式,按找到的方法没能找回虚拟机文件

一图:VMWARE系统的文件读取故障提示,这是系统没有完成崩溃前的样子. 二图:这是在看到上图提示后,我用alt+F12看到的虚拟内核LOG的提示. 三图:是重新启动系统后,进入修复模式后在这一步没办法继续后的照片. 四图:按正常启动时的提示 初步判断为引导文件损坏,处理办法在官网上查到的是 http://wiki.centos.org/TipsAndTricks/ReinstallGRUB 按找到的方法没能通过修复模式找回虚拟机文件.发现VMware4.1没有修复模式,只能安装.数据看来是找不

VMware虚拟机配置文件(.vmx)损坏修复

前言: 对于VMware虚拟机配置文件(.vmx)损坏 大家发生问题的原因可能跟我不一样,但是解决方法应该是一样的. 但是本方法仅适用.vmx文件损坏而其他文件完好无损的情况. 问题发生: 最近一直在研究hadoop,今天刚搭建完HBase,用的时候就感觉速度很慢,结果在执行HBase shell的时候,卡住不动了.然后就报错了错误信息...忘记了内容了...然后虚拟机就崩溃了,然后这个虚拟机再也打不开了,提示我的.vmx文件已损坏. VMware虚拟机中使用.vmx文件保存虚拟机的所有软硬件配

修复损坏的gz或tar.gz压缩文件之方法篇

接修复损坏的gzip压缩文件之原理篇,再次引用GZIP结构图: 在上一篇中已知,修复一个损坏的gzip文件的关键环节在于找到下一个正常压缩包的起始点.根据结构图中的信息可知,每个压缩包的开始结构中有是否到达尾部标志.使用的哈夫曼树类型.以及3个哈夫曼树的树元素个数等.如果某个gzip文件中间有一个坏扇区,要找到坏扇区后的一个正常起点,仅需按位右移,一直移位到可以正常解压的某个位,就可能找到了正确的压缩包起始.而根据gzip文件的压缩作业窗口为32KB大小推算,这个遍历不会超过64KB即可找到.在

如何将VMWare Workstation 虚拟机文件导入到ESX Server——VMX 转成 OVF 格式

1.关于VMX格式 VMX文件是vmware虚拟机系统的配置文件,注意:刚刚安装好VMware Workstation以后是找不到这个文件的,当你在VMware Workstation中建立了一个虚拟机以后,这个文件才会出现.这文件是用来记录你建立的虚拟机的配置的,比如多大的内存.什么型号的硬盘 等等. 2.OVF格式 Open Virtualization Format (OVF) 规范是在 Distributed Management Task Force (DMTF) 协会内部开发的一种标

OS X Yosemite中VMware Fusion实验环境的虚拟机文件位置备忘

Host OS版本: OS X Yosemite  10.10.2 虚拟机软件版本:VMware Fusion 专业版 6.0.4 (1887983) 起因:换Mac了,对此系统还在熟悉当中,熟悉的过程中有一些问题,就此记下. 一.虚拟机被安装在哪里了? 在OS X操作系统中安装了VMware Fusion虚拟机软件,在VMware Fusion中安装了两个虚拟机. VMware Fusion默认将虚拟机的文件安装在:         当前用户的  -->家目录下的  -->"文稿&

vmware打开虚拟级断电情况下,无法找到虚拟机文件

1.此时会在建立的虚拟机目录下,有一些 %虚拟机名字%.vmx.lck 或者别的   %虚拟机名字%.***.lck   删除这些文件夹 2.虚拟文件 是一个后缀名为vmx的文件,发现断电后 变成了vmx~.直接更名为vmx  然后用虚拟机打开即可 3.忠告:既然是虚拟机,除非你删了虚拟系统的很多东西无法恢复,否则不需要重新安装的. 多动手查查就好 vmware打开虚拟级断电情况下,无法找到虚拟机文件

VMware虚拟机文件(后缀)详解

VMware虚拟机文件(后缀)详解 虚拟机的文件管理由VMware Workstation来执行,一个虚拟机一般以一系列文件的形式储存在宿主机中,这些文件一般在由workstation为虚拟机所创建的那个目录中.这里列出了这些关键文件的扩展名.在这些例子中,<vmname>表示你的虚拟机名字. .log <vm name>.log or vmware.log这个文件记录了VMware Workstation对虚拟机调节运行的情况.当你碰到问题时,这些文件对我们做出故障诊断非常有用.

从损坏的wt文件中恢复出WiredTiger集合

Reference: http://dev.guanghe.tv/2016/06/recovering-a-wiredtiger-collection-from-a-corrupt-wt-file.html 常在河边走,哪能不湿鞋.虽然说只要不使用kill -9杀进程,一般不会导致MongoDB出问题(Mongo本身有对kill做处理),但是程序总有跑偏的时候,也许哪次服务器重启或者遇到断电之类的,没准就会导致数据库文件损坏. 当然一般的异常关闭后启动不了时可能也就是删除一下lock.pid文件